有没有办法在 DBeaver 的 SQL 脚本中定义结果选项卡的名称?
Is there a way to define the names of the result tabs names in an SQL Script in DBeaver?
我正在创建一个 MySQL 脚本,该脚本在一条记录上运行并从一系列其他 table 中提取相关记录,这非常有用,但在 DBeaver 中,结果以选项卡形式返回只有 table 结果的名称,这非常有用,但有时让选项卡准确显示结果会更有用。
有没有一种方法可以在 SQL 脚本中指定 DBeaver 拾取的结果应命名为选项卡名称?
在 DBeaver 中,如果我执行以下脚本 (Opt+X):
SELECT *
FROM
partnerships;
SELECT id, name, owner_id
FROM
partnerships
WHERE
name LIKE '%wp%';
两个查询的结果出现在 DBeaver 屏幕底部的两个不同选项卡中,一个名为 partnerships
,另一个名为 partnerships-1
。我想问的是,是否有办法让这些选项卡对我来说更有意义,比如 All Partnerships
和 WP Partnerships
。
事实证明,您实际上可以在查询前使用 SQL 注释来定义标题。如:
-- title: WP Named Partnerships
SELECT id, name, owner_id
FROM
partnerships
WHERE
name LIKE '%wp%';
这将使 WP Named Partnerships
成为结果选项卡的标题。
我正在创建一个 MySQL 脚本,该脚本在一条记录上运行并从一系列其他 table 中提取相关记录,这非常有用,但在 DBeaver 中,结果以选项卡形式返回只有 table 结果的名称,这非常有用,但有时让选项卡准确显示结果会更有用。
有没有一种方法可以在 SQL 脚本中指定 DBeaver 拾取的结果应命名为选项卡名称?
在 DBeaver 中,如果我执行以下脚本 (Opt+X):
SELECT *
FROM
partnerships;
SELECT id, name, owner_id
FROM
partnerships
WHERE
name LIKE '%wp%';
两个查询的结果出现在 DBeaver 屏幕底部的两个不同选项卡中,一个名为 partnerships
,另一个名为 partnerships-1
。我想问的是,是否有办法让这些选项卡对我来说更有意义,比如 All Partnerships
和 WP Partnerships
。
事实证明,您实际上可以在查询前使用 SQL 注释来定义标题。如:
-- title: WP Named Partnerships
SELECT id, name, owner_id
FROM
partnerships
WHERE
name LIKE '%wp%';
这将使 WP Named Partnerships
成为结果选项卡的标题。